@charset "utf-8";
/* CSS Document */
body {margin: 0; font-family:Georgia; font-size:11px; line-height:1.8em; color:#58595b; background:url(../images/tasarim/bgr-global-05.png) #666666; }
h4 {clear:both; margin:0 0 10px 0; font-family:Georgia; font-size:11px; font-style:italic; font-weight:normal; }
h3 {clear:both; margin:0 0 5px 0; font-family:Georgia; font-size:13px; font-style:italic; font-weight:normal;  }
h2 {clear:both; margin:0 0 10px 0; font-family:Georgia; font-size:16px; font-style:italic; font-weight:normal; }
h1 {clear:both; font-family:Georgia; font-size:20px; font-style:italic; font-weight:normal; /*text-indent:10px;*/ padding-top:13px; }
p {margin:10px 0 3px 0; padding:0;}

.container {float:none; margin:auto; width:960px;}
.container02 {float:right; margin:auto; width:800px; }
.altiniciz {border-bottom:1px dashed #CCC; padding-bottom:10px; margin-bottom:20px;}

.beyaz, .beyaz a:link, .beyaz a:visited {color:#fff; text-decoration:none; }
.beyaz a:hover {text-decoration:underline;}

.darkblue, .darkblue a:link, .darkblue a:visited {color:#0b5382; text-decoration:none; }
.darkblue a:hover {color:#000; }

.fairblue, .fairblue a:link, .fairblue a:visited {color:#137abd; text-decoration:none; }
.fairblue a:hover {color:#000; }

.orange, .orange a:link, .orange a:visited {color:#f26522; text-decoration:none; }
.orange a:hover {color:#000; }

.gray, .gray a:link, .gray a:visited {color:#58595b; text-decoration:none; }
.gray a:hover {color:#000; }

.green, .green a:link, .green a:visited {color:#969c00; text-decoration:none; }
.green a:hover {color:#000; }

.yellow, .yellow a:link, .yellow a:visited {color:#ffcb05; text-decoration:none; }
.yellow a:hover {color:#ffcb05; }

.tiny {font-size:9px; font-family:"Trebuchet MS";}
.font-normal {font-size:12px;}
.kalin {font-weight:bold;}

.thumbnail {float:left; width:82px; margin-right:10px; min-height:60px; max-height:80px; overflow:hidden; }
.imgthumbnail  {border:1px solid #d3d4d4;}
.thumbspot {float:left; margin:35px 0 0 0; width:200px; height:39px; text-align:center; }
.fixer{clear:both; float:none; width:100%; height:1px;}

#top {width:100%; height:40px; background:#58595b;}
#search {float:right; margin:auto; padding:0 9px 0 9px; width:210px; height:25px; background:url(../images/tasarim/bgr-search.png) no-repeat;}
.button-ara {margin:0 10px 0 10px; padding-bottom:2px; width:50px; height:18px; font-size:9px; border:none; background:url(../images/tasarim/button-ara.png);}

#topmenu {float:left; /*width:300px;*/ height:21px; font-size:10px; }
#topmenu ul {float:left; margin:0; list-style-type:none; }
#topmenu ul li {display:block; float:left; text-align:center; }
#topmenu ul li a {display:inline; float:left; height:18px; width:80px; padding:3px 0 0 0; margin:0 5px 0 0; background:url(../images/tasarim/button-01.png) bottom; }
#topmenu ul li a:hover, #stylefour ul li a.current {background:url(../images/tasarim/button-01-hover.png) bottom; }

#inventorblock {clear:both; width:100%; background:#586b75; height:130px;}
#inventors {float:none; margin:auto; width:960px; height:130px; background:url(../images/tasarim/bgr-mucit.png);}

#vitrin_mucitler {width:740px; height:130px; float:right;}
#logo {float:left; margin:20px 20px auto 0; width:180px;}
.ok {float:left; margin:20px 0 0 20px; width:36px;}

.imginventorcontainer {float:left; margin:24px 0 0 20px; width:60px; height:103px; background:url(../images/tasarim/reflection.png); } 
.imginventor {width:50px; height:50px; overflow:hidden; border:#fff 5px solid; } 

.textfield {margin:0; padding:2px; height:14px; font-size:10px; border:1px solid #fff;}

#ustblok {clear:both; float:none; margin:0 auto; padding:10px; width:960px; height:240px; background:url(../images/tasarim/bgr-ust-blok-02.png); }
#ustblokic {float:none; margin:0 auto; width:960px; }

#ipcmenu {float:left; margin:0; padding:0; width:140px; font-size:10px; background:url(../images/tasarim/bgr-ipc-menu.png) no-repeat; }
#ipcmenu ul {float:left; margin:0px; padding:0; list-style:none; width:140px; }
#ipcmenu ul li {float:left; margin:0; text-align:left; }
#ipcmenu ul li a {display:block; float:left; margin:0 0 2px 0; padding:5px 0 0 10px; color:#ffffff; text-decoration:none; height:20px; width:130px;  }
#ipcmenu ul li a:hover, #stylefour ul li a.current {float:left; margin:0 0 2px 0; color:#ffffff; text-decoration:none;  }

.ipcbutton01 {background:url(../images/tasarim/ipc01.png) no-repeat;}
.ipcbutton01 a:hover {background:url(../images/tasarim/ipc01hover.png) no-repeat;}
.ipcbutton02 {background:url(../images/tasarim/ipc02.png) no-repeat;}
.ipcbutton02 a:hover {background:url(../images/tasarim/ipc02hover.png) no-repeat;}
.ipcbutton03 {background:url(../images/tasarim/ipc03.png) no-repeat;}
.ipcbutton03 a:hover {background:url(../images/tasarim/ipc03hover.png) no-repeat;}
.ipcbutton04 {background:url(../images/tasarim/ipc04.png) no-repeat;}
.ipcbutton04 a:hover {background:url(../images/tasarim/ipc04hover.png) no-repeat;}

.textmenu	{float:right; margin:0 0 0 20px;padding:20px 0 0 20px; width:160px; background:url(../images/tasarim/cross_b.png) top left no-repeat; }
.alignright {text-align:right;}

#main {clear:both; float:none; margin:0 auto 0 auto; padding:15px 20px 10px 20px; background:#e4e4de; width:940px; }


/* ============================*/
/* ========= 1. KOLON =========*/
/* ============================*/

.column01 {float:left; width:290px; }
.column01 h1 {font-family:Georgia, serif; font-weight:normal; font-style:italic; font-size:22px; line-height:20px; color:#58595b; padding-top:0px; margin:0px; text-indent:0px; }

.column01 ul {margin-top:0; padding:0 0 0 0;}
.column01 li {border-bottom:1px dotted #CCC; padding:5px 5px 0 5px;  overflow:visible;   }
.column01 li:hover { background:#fff; }
.column01 li a:link {text-decoration:none; }
.column01 li a:visited {text-decoration:none; }
.column01 li a:hover {text-decoration:underline;}
.column01 .showall {position:relative; bottom:0px; right:0px; height:20px;}

.c01modulcontainer1 {float:none; width:270px; margin-bottom:20px; padding: 10px 10px 10px 10px; background:url(../images/tasarim/bgr-bizimkiler.png) top no-repeat #ffe98e; -moz-border-radius: 7px; -webkit-border-radius: 7px; }
.c01modulcontainer2 {float:none; width:270px; margin-bottom:20px; padding: 10px 10px 10px 10px; background:url(../images/tasarim/bgr-everest.png) top no-repeat #ceedf8; -moz-border-radius: 7px; -webkit-border-radius: 7px; }
.c01modulcontainer3 {float:none; width:270px; margin-bottom:20px; padding: 10px 10px 10px 10px; background:url(../images/tasarim/bgr-yorumlar.png) top no-repeat #e5f1d4; -moz-border-radius: 7px; -webkit-border-radius: 7px; }

/* ============================*/
/* ========= 2. KOLON =========*/
/* ============================*/


.column02 {float:left; margin:0; width:310px; }
.c02modulcontainer {float:none; width:295px; margin:0 0 20px 0; padding: 20px 10px 5px 5px; }

.column03 {float:right; margin:0; width:310px; }

.bgorange {background:#fff7e5; }
.bggray {background:#f4f4ee; }
.bggreen {background:#e1eecf; }
.bggreen2 {background:#eef2dc; }

div.spotcontainer, div.spotcontainer_anket {float:left; margin:0; padding:10px 2px 10px 10px; min-height:45px; font-family:Tahoma; font-size:10px; border-top:1px dotted #d6d6b4; }
div.spotcontainer:hover {background:url(../images/tasarim/bgr-hover-blue.png) left no-repeat #fff;}

div.spotcontainer2 {float:left; margin:0; padding:10px 2px 10px 10px; min-height:45px; font-family:Tahoma; font-size:10px; border-top:1px dotted #d6d6b4; }
div.spotcontainer2:hover {background:#fff;}


div.spotcontainerlong {float:left; margin:0 0 0px 0; padding:10px 0 7px 10px; width:285px; font-family:Tahoma; font-size:10px; border-top:1px dotted #d6d6b4;}
div.spotcontainerlong:hover {background:url(../images/tasarim/bgr-hover-orange.png) left no-repeat #fff; }

.spottext {float:right; margin:auto; width:150px; padding:0 5px 0 5px; }
.spottextlong {float:right; margin:auto; width:181px; padding:0 5px 0 5px; }
.links {float:right; margin: 0; width:171px; padding-right:5px; }
.linkslong {float:right; margin: 0; width:181px; padding-right:5px; }

.comment {float:right; margin:auto; width:265px; padding-right:5px; }
.commentlong {float:left; margin:auto; width:275px; padding-right:5px; }

div.commentlinks {float:left; margin:5px 0 0 0; width:270px; padding-right:5px; }
div.commentlinks a:hover {float:left; margin:5px 0 0 0; width:270px; padding-right:5px; }

.commentlinkslong {float:left; margin:0px 0 0 0; width:270px; padding-right:5px; }

.videocontainer {width:300px; margin-bottom:15px; }
.containervideolist {float:right; margin:0 auto 10px auto; width:280px; height:220px; overflow:auto; }
.videolistitem {float:left; width:260px; height:60px; margin:0 auto 10px auto; padding-bottom:10px; border-bottom:1px dotted #d6d6b4; }
.videothumb {float:left; width:80px;height:60px; margin-right:20px; }
.videotext {float:right; width:160px; }

.vitrin_kapsayan {float:left; margin:0 auto 20px 0; width:630px; padding:15px 0; height:220px; overflow:hidden; background:url(../images/tasarim/bgr-manset.png);}
.vitrin_kapsayan_alt{float:left; margin:0; padding:15px 15px 15px 15px; width:570px; height:235px; background:#a7a9ac}
.vitrin_kapsayan h1 {font-family:Georgia, serif; font-weight:normal; font-style:italic; font-size:22px; line-height:25px; color:#58595b; padding-top:0px; margin:0px; text-indent:0px; }
.vitrin_kapsayan h1 a {color:#262626; text-decoration:none; }
.vitrin_kapsayan h1 a:hover {text-decoration:underline; }

.vitrin_kapsayan .aciklama {font-family:Georgia; font-size:12px; font-style:italic; font-weight:bold; color:#3e87ad;}
.vitrin_kapsayan .aciklama a {color:#3e87ad; text-decoration:none;}
.vitrin_kapsayan .aciklama a:hover {color:#3e87ad; text-decoration:underline;}
.vitrin_kapsayan .metin {font-family:Georgia; font-size:11px; line-height:1.7em; color:#58595b; letter-spacing:-1px; font-weight:bold;}

.vitrin_sol_ok{float:left; margin-top:100px; width:35px; height:31px;text-align:center;}
.vitrin_sag_ok{float:left; margin-top:100px; width:35px; height:31px;text-align:center;  }

.vitrin_kapsayan_ic{float:left; width:560px; height:220px; margin:0; }
.vitrin_patent_resim{float:left; margin:0; width:190px; height:180px; overflow:hidden; border:5px solid #f1f2f2; }
.vitrin_text{float:left; margin-top:140px; width:540px; padding:5px 10px; height:70px; line-height:1.3em; overflow: hidden; background:url(../images/tasarim/manset-text-bgr.png);  }

.pageheader_blue {float:left; width:630px; height:55px; padding-left:10px; background:url(../images/tasarim/pageheader-blue.png) no-repeat;}
.pageheader_blue_long {float:left; width:960px; height:40px; margin-bottom:15px; background:url(../images/tasarim/pageheader-blue-long.png);}

.pageheader_orange {float:left; width:630px; height:40px; margin-bottom:15px; background:url(../images/tasarim/pageheader-orange.png);}
.pageheader_gray {float:left; width:630px; height:40px; margin-bottom:15px; background:url(../images/tasarim/pageheader-gray.png);}
.pageheader_green {float:left; width:630px; height:40px; margin-bottom:15px; background:url(../images/tasarim/pageheader-green.png);}

.subcontainer {float:left; width:590px; margin-bottom:15px; padding:0px 20px 10px 20px; background:/*url(../images/tasarim/subfooter.png) bottom repeat-x*/ #f1f2f2; -moz-border-radius: 7px; -webkit-border-radius: 7px;  }
.subcontainer_long {float:left; width:900px; margin-bottom:15px; padding:0px 20px 10px 20px; background:/*url(../images/tasarim/subfooter.png) bottom repeat-x*/ #f1f2f2; -moz-border-radius: 7px; -webkit-border-radius: 7px;  }
.subtitle {margin:10px 0; }

.showallblue {float:left; margin:0; padding:5px 5px 0px 10px; width:270px; height:20px; border-top:1px dotted #d6d6b4; }
.showallblue:hover {background:url(../images/tasarim/bgr-hover-blue.png) left no-repeat #fff;}
.showallorange {float:left; margin:0; padding:5px 5px 0px 10px; width:270px; height:20px; border-top:1px dotted #d6d6b4; }
.showallorange:hover {background:url(../images/tasarim/bgr-hover-orange.png) left no-repeat #fff;}

.textfield { border:1px #c8dcdc dotted; font-family:Verdana; font-size:12px; padding:4px; margin:10px 0 5px 0; }
.textarea { border:1px #c8dcdc dotted; font-family:Verdana; font-size:12px; padding:4px; margin:10px 0 5px 0; height:50px; }
.button { border-bottom:1px #4696af solid; border-right:1px #4696af solid; border-left:1px #a0d7e6 solid; border-top:1px #a0d7e6 solid; height:20px; padding-bottom:4px; color:#fff; font-size:10px; background:#73b9cd; }

#footer{float: none; clear:both; padding:5px 20px 0 0; margin:10px auto 10px auto; width:960px; height:60px; text-align:right; background:#666666;}

.listglobal {}
.listglobal ul {padding-left:25px; margin-left:15px;}
.listglobal li, li a, li a:visited {list-style:square inside; color:#666; text-decoration:none;}
.listglobal li a:hover {color:#007dc5; text-decoration:underline;}

.social{float:left;padding-left:20px; margin-top:15px;}

/* ============================*/
/* ======= YENİ BÖLÜMLER =======*/
/* ============================*/


#quickmenucontainer {clear:both; float:none; width:952px; margin:10px auto; padding:14px; background:#666666; }
.quickmenu  {float:none; margin: 0 auto; width:960px;  -moz-border-radius: 7px; -webkit-border-radius: 7px; }
.quickmenulist {float:left; margin-right:12px; padding:8px; width:210px; height:160px; background:#f1f2f2; -moz-border-radius: 7px; -webkit-border-radius: 7px; border:1px solid #d4dbd9; }
.quickmenu ul {margin-top:0; padding:0 0 0 0;}
.quickmenu li {border-bottom:1px dotted #CCC; padding:5px 5px 0 5px; height:16px; overflow:hidden;   }
.quickmenu li:hover { background:#fff; }
.quickmenu li a:link {color:#0c6f8c; text-decoration:none; }
.quickmenu li a:visited {color:#0c6f8c; text-decoration:none; }
.quickmenu li a:hover{color:#0c6f8c; text-decoration:underline;}
.showall {position:relative; bottom:0px; right:0px; height:20px;}

.anasayfaspot {width:610px; height:100px;  padding:10px; background:url(../images/tasarim/bgr-spot-3.png) center; margin-bottom:10px;}
.anasayfaspot h3 {font-family:Georgia, serif; font-weight:normal; font-style:italic; font-size:16px; line-height:20px; color:#58595b; padding-top:0px; margin:0 0 5px 0px; text-indent:0px; }
.anasayfaspot h3 a {color:#58595b; text-decoration:none; }
.anasayfaspot h3 a:hover {text-decoration:underline; }

.anasayfaspot .text {font-family:Georgia, serif; font-weight:normal; font-size:11px; line-height:15px; color:#58595b; }


#globalnavigatorcontainer {float:none; width:100%; height:40px; background:#f9f9f9;}
#globalnavigator {float:none; height:40px; width:940px; text-align:left; margin:auto; padding:0; }
.nav {float:left; background:#f9f9f9; height:40px; width:auto; min-width:290px; margin:0; padding:0; font-size:11px; }
.nav a{color:#2e7183; text-decoration:none; }
.nav a:hover {}
.nav ul {height:30px; float:left; margin:5px 0 0 0; list-style:none; padding:0; }
.nav li {float:left; padding:0; position:relative; z-index:1; }
.nav li a {float:left; display:inline; line-height:20px; overflow:hidden; padding:0; }
.nav li.first {background:none; }
.nav li a:visited {color:#0c6f8c; }
.nav li a:hover {color:#000000; }

.nav li:hover .sub,
.nav li.hover .sub {display:block; }
.nav li .sub {display:none; position:absolute; top:30px; left:0px; background:url(../images/tasarim/submenu_top.png) no-repeat; width:280px; margin:0; padding-top:5px; }
.nav li ul {color:#e6b222; font-weight:bold; background:url(../images/tasarim/submenu_bg.png) repeat-y; width:260px; height:auto; margin:4px 0 0 0; padding:0 12px 10px; list-style:none; font-size:11px; }


.nav li:hover li {width:256px; padding:1px 0 2px 0; border-bottom:1px #C1D9F0 dashed; background:none; line-height:20px;  }
.nav li:hover li a {color:#09548B; font-weight:normal;  background:none !important; line-height:normal;  padding:8px 3px 8px 0; text-indent:1px; }
.nav li:hover li a:hover {color:#000000; !important; text-decoration:none; line-height:normal; }

/*IE*/
.nav li li a:hover,
.nav li li a:hover {color:#000000; !important; text-decoration:none; line-height:normal;}

/**/
.nav .btm-bg {background:url(../images/tasarim/submenu_bottom.png) no-repeat; width:285px; height:10px; overflow:hidden; clear:both; }

.ogren {font-family:Georgia; font-size:12px; font-style:italic; color:#333;}


